2026 2L Summer Law Clerk - Fargo, ND

Fredrikson & Byron is the premier Midwest-based law firm working collaboratively to help businesses achieve their goals regionally, nationally, and globally. They are seeking a 2L Summer Law Clerk who will graduate from law school in 2027 to join the Fargo office in Summer 2026.

Qualification

Analytical skillsWriting skillsProblem-solving skillsLeadership experienceClient orientationEntrepreneurial spiritTeamworkInitiativeRelationship building

Required

Must be a 2L student graduating from law school in 2027
Strong intellectual, problem-solving, analytical, and writing skills
Participation in leadership roles in schools or communities
Skills and interest in teamwork, entrepreneurial spirit, taking initiative, client-orientation, and relationship building

Preferred

Students who are in the top 25% of their class
Ties to or interest in North Dakota
